Output 67ed384bf611ab698d77bd6286da5a904a89abf85851913f51ce3c394182234e:0

value
619666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130ae696a54b8cba5206bea139b1eb7ae62837e7 OP_EQUAL
address
33Rhpat4Azj2Z9Ww7842V5Ry81QEDHA7oc
transaction
67ed384bf611ab698d77bd6286da5a904a89abf85851913f51ce3c394182234e
confirmations
252687
spent
true